How long will it take to get my order?
Once an order is placed it usually takes 3-7 business days for us to print and process it. After your order is processed it will be shipped. Time in transit for shipping from our warehouse to your front door can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the the shipping method you select during checkout.
This info is readily available on this site. The shirts are printed to order. They're never printed and ready to go when the shirt goes up for sale.

A word from the curator: Sometimes even Edgar Allen Poe likes to loosen up and have some fun!
Tell us a bit about this design. I just woke up one day had that this idea in my head, and I have no idea where it came from. I just couldn't stop thinking about it for a couple of weeks, and ended up putting this design down just to stop the voices in my head. I was going to also do a design called "The Tell Tale Hearth Bakery" as a sort of companion piece, but never got around to it. Where are you from? I'm originally from Gardena, California, where (coincidentally), that question was the precursor to every gang fight I witnessed in High School. I'm currently living in the St Louis, MO area. What do you want TeeFury fans to know about you? I once punched a hole through a cow, just to see who was coming up the road. I also color "The Boys", the best comic book on the racks. What do you absolutely not want them to find out? I have an irrational fear of irrational fears. Name a few of your favorite things. Taco trucks, the street food in downtown LA, tacos, cooking tacos and watching B-movies while eating tacos. Oh, I also like Tacos. What are your feelings about the ocean? I used to love that fool, but we have had beef ever since he destroyed my phone, jerk! Would you rather play a sport or coach the team? Play for sure. Camping vs. hotels: which would win the battle? Hotels, because of work. I need to be connected to the internet at all times, because comic deadlines can be pretty crazy and you just never know when something will need to be tweaked. Describe your favorite shirt that you own, and why you like it so much. "Punched Out!!" by 8-Bit Zombie. The art features King Hippo from Mike Tyson's Punchout. I'm partly drawn to the shirt because Punchout! is maybe my favorite game ever, but what really makes it great is the art. The print is huge on the shirt, and the illustration is everything I wish my designs could be. The style of the drawing is bugged out and the color choices are amazing. Which is better, gaming, reading, or watching movies? Name your favorite title in your chosen medium. Watching movies. It's hard to narrow it down to one title, so I'll leave a recommendation: The Room. If you haven't seen Tommy Wiseau's classic, run out and see it right now, if you've already seen it, run out and see it again right now! What inspires your work? Anything and every creative. I'm listening to Busdriver's album "Jhelli Beam" as I type this and it makes me want to push myself creatively. I got my start as a graffiti artist, but I try to pull my inspiration from all over the place. Lately I've been on a big Rick Griffin kick. Any shout outs? Big ups to my wife Lorie for kicking me in the butt when I get lazy and my family for being awesome. Hi Mom!
